BY1 Junmai Ginjo, freshly squeezed raw sake, so it has a nice aroma!
A little dry!
I thought it would be spicier, but it's not.
The one on the right with tuna also has plums in it, which gives it a sour taste and goes well with the dry sake!
extensive knowledge
Rice used: Gohyakumangoku
Rice polishing ratio: 55
Sake degree ... +5
Acidity・・・1.7
Alcohol content・・・16
